Target, a well-known retail store, has received a mix of reviews from its customers. The store is generally praised for its cleanliness and organization, with one customer noting that Walmart is trying to emulate Target's appearance. The staff is a point of contention, with some customers finding the employees to be friendly and helpful, while others report encountering grumpy or indifferent employees. The store's pricing and sales practices have also been criticized, with one customer reporting that the sales signs were incorrect, and the staff was hesitant to honor the advertised price. Another customer, however, has been a loyal shopper for 13 years and has never had any issues with the store's customer service or the quality of its products. The store's pharmacy has received positive feedback, but the checkout process has been a source of frustration for some customers. Long lines and slow response times from management to assist with checkout have been noted. Additionally, some pickup employees have been criticized for their handling of customers' orders, with reports of items being thrown or stacked improperly. Overall, Target appears to be a mixed bag, with some customers finding it to be a pleasant shopping experience, while others have encountered issues with the staff, pricing, and logistics.
